One week has passed since Mzia Amaghlobeli began her hunger strike. Today, her letter was released, which we present unchanged:
“The fact for which I am accused today is the result of repressive, treasonous, violent processes directed against human speech and expression, processes that have been developing for the past year and are taking root in our daily lives as dictatorship.
I do not intend to accept the regime’s agenda. I am on hunger strike.
Freedom is more valuable than life.
Any citizen who wants to live in a democratic, fair, European Georgia free from Russian influences could find themselves in my situation.
Fight before it’s too late.
Fight wherever you are,
Whether in the country or abroad.
In villages or cities, in streets or auditoriums,
In public and work spaces.
Be brave, take care of and strengthen each other.
Do not allow Georgia to be isolated from the civilized world.”
